예제 #1
0
        public void PushMessage()
        {
            Logger.Push("Test Message");
            var messages = Logger.Get();

            Assert.NotNull(messages);
            Assert.That(messages.Count == 1);
        }
예제 #2
0
        public void FlushCollectionOfMessage()
        {
            Logger.Push("Test Message 1");
            Logger.Push("Test Message 2");
            Logger.Push("Test Message 3");
            var messages = Logger.Flush();

            Assert.NotNull(messages);
            CollectionAssert.IsNotEmpty(messages);
            Assert.That(messages.Count == 3);
        }
예제 #3
0
        public void GetMessages()
        {
            var messages = Logger.Get();

            Assert.NotNull(messages);
            CollectionAssert.IsEmpty(messages);

            Logger.Push("Test Message 1");
            Logger.Push("Test Message 2");
            Logger.Push("Test Message 3");
            messages = Logger.Get();

            Assert.That(messages.Count == 3);
        }